3 Common Reasons For Water Discolorations on Wall Surfaces


Contrary to popular belief, water discolorations on walls do not always stem from poor structure materials. There are a number of causes of water spots on walls. These consist of:

Poor Drain


When making a structure plan, it is critical to guarantee adequate water drainage. This will stop water from permeating into the wall surfaces. Where the drain system is obstructed or nonexistent, below ground moisture develops. This web links to extreme moisture that you notice on the wall surfaces of your structure.
So, the leading cause of wet wall surfaces, in this instance, can be a poor water drainage system. It can likewise result from inadequate management of sewage pipelines that run through the building.

Wet


When hot damp air meets dry chilly air, it creates water droplets to form on the wall surfaces of structures. When there is heavy steam from food preparation or showers, this takes place in bathrooms and kitchen areas. The water droplets can tarnish the bordering walls in these parts of your home as well as infect various other locations.
Wet or condensation influences the roof covering and also walls of buildings. When the wall is wet, it creates a suitable atmosphere for the growth of microorganisms as well as fungi.

Pipeline Leaks


A lot of houses have a network of pipes within the wall surfaces. This makes sure that the pipelines are faraway from the reach of harmful rats. It constantly boosts the feasibility of such pipelines, as there is little oxygen within the wall surfaces. This prevents rust.
Yet, a disadvantage to this is that water leak influences the wall surfaces of the building as well as causes widespread damage. A dead giveaway of malfunctioning pipes is the appearance of a water stain on the wall surface.

Water Discolorations on Wall Surface: Repair Work Tips


Property owners would generally desire a quick fix when taking care of water spots. Yet, they would quickly recognize this is counterproductive as the water discolorations persist. So, below are a few useful pointers that will direct you in the repair of water discolorations on walls:
  • Constantly take care of the source of water spots on walls

  • Involve the help of specialist repair work solutions

  • Method regular cleanliness and clean clogged sewer system

  • When developing a home in a water logged area, make certain that the workers perform proper grading

  • Tiling locations that are prone to high condensation, such as the kitchen and bathroom, aids in decreasing the accumulation of damp

  • Dehumidifiers are additionally useful in maintaining the moisture levels at bay

  • Pro Idea


    A houseplant in your home likewise increases its moisture. So, if the house is already moist, you may intend to introduce houseplants with very little transpiration. An example of ideal houseplants is succulents.

    How to Remove Water Stains From Your Walls Without Repainting


    The easy way to get water stains off walls


    Water stains aren’t going to appear on tile; they need a more absorbent surface, which is why they show up on bare walls. Since your walls are probably painted, this presents a problem: How can you wash a wall without damaging it and risk needing to repait the entire room?


    According to Igloo Surfaces, you should start gently and only increase the intensity of your cleaning methods if basic remedies don’t get the job done. Start with a simple solution of dish soap and warm water, at a ratio of about one to two. Use a cloth dipped in the mixture to apply the soapy water to your stain. Gently rub it in from the top down, then rinse with plain water and dry thoroughly with a hair dryer on a cool setting.



    If that doesn’t work, fill a spray bottle with a mixture of vinegar, lemon juice, and baking soda. Shake it up and spray it on the stain. Leave it for about an hour, then use a damp cloth to rub it away. You may have to repeat this process a few times to get the stain all the way out, so do this when you have time for multiple hour-long soaking intervals.


    How to get water stains out of wood


    Maybe you have wood paneling or cabinets that are looking grody from water stains too, whether in your kitchen or bathroom. Per Better Homes and Gardens, you have a few options for removing water marks on your wooden surfaces.


  • You can let mayonnaise sit on your stain overnight, then wipe it away in the morning and polish your wood afterward.


  • You can also mix equal parts vinegar and olive oil and apply to the stain with a cloth, wiping in the direction of the grain until the stain disappears. Afterward, wipe the surface down with a clean, dry cloth.


  • Try placing an iron on a low heat setting over a cloth on top of the stain. Press it down for a few seconds and remove it to see if the stain is letting up, then try again until you’re satisfied. (Be advised that this works best for still-damp stains.)
